How did you prepare for the interview?

Read my application, spoke with med students there, went to the Upstate library and spoke with the staff and they gave me some additional information about the school. Spoke with Pre-med advisor.

What impressed you positively?

Everything is so close to each other (labs, classes, hospital, dorm, apartments)

What impressed you negatively?

Nothing.

What did you wish you had known ahead of time?

That you could leave your luggage in school.

What are your general comments?

The interviews were ok, but I was proactive and I ask you all to be in this phase. My interviewers not only wanted to know about me, but I also wanted to know about the school and if its a good fit for me.
